Key NU players for this weekend’s tilt vs OSU:
Erica Owczarczak – I believe this senior defender will be assigned (when possible) to go against Spooner’s line. No easy task, so good luck.
Erin Burns – A junior defender that transferred from Syracuse logs plenty of minutes and will continue to tonight.
Point leaders So Jessica Hitchcock (13), Jr Kelsey Welch (13), and Jr Jenna Hendrikx (11) always seem to generate scoring chances and will need to continue to do so.
Kaleigh Chippy – A sophomore forward with great hands has only 3 goals on the season but could be 10. Slick player that needs to shoot more often.
Kayla Raniwsky – leads all freshmen with 3-5-8 points. Gets her points by going to the tough areas and coming out with the puck.
Players due for a breakout game:
Kristin Richards – this sophomore forward is better than her current 5 points on the season. She is a big strong player that gets chances, but hasn’t been able to finish. Maybe tonight!
Kathleen Bortuzzo – Junior forward with only 2 goals and 5 points on the season. Her slow start is due to an early season injury, but she is better every time out. Look for her to play top minutes.
Amy Helfrich – is a 5’1” freshmen forward with only 2 assists on the season. Early on Amy has not played/averaged many minutes per game, but is getting more with each passing game. She is a feisty little player that can cause the opposition to turn over the puck in their end. Watch for her to get her first goal this weekend..... Off a turn over.
Goaltending: Not sure who's getting the start, but Moses has played the last three games.
Sara Moses So (2-4-3) GAA - 3.45 SA% .875
Abby Ryplanski Fr (5-2-1) GAA - 1.74 SA% .930
